|
|
@@ -91,6 +91,7 @@ define(['jquery', 'bootstrap', 'backend', 'table', 'form','jQuery.print','jquery
|
|
|
data:{bach:bach},//批次号
|
|
|
url:"feeding/get_task",
|
|
|
success(res){
|
|
|
+ // $("#table").append("<input id='name' type='hidden' value='"+res.data.name+"'>");
|
|
|
$("#table").append("<input id='name' type='hidden' value='"+res.data[0].name+"'>");
|
|
|
//批次号重复/做下拉选择
|
|
|
if(res.data.length>1){
|
|
|
@@ -205,6 +206,9 @@ define(['jquery', 'bootstrap', 'backend', 'table', 'form','jQuery.print','jquery
|
|
|
$("#c-name").val(res.data[0].name);
|
|
|
$("#c-specifications").val(res.data[0].drawer_name);
|
|
|
$("#c-unit").val(res.data[0].examine_name);
|
|
|
+ // $("#c-name").val(res.data.name);
|
|
|
+ // $("#c-specifications").val(res.data.drawer_name);
|
|
|
+ // $("#c-unit").val(res.data.examine_name);
|
|
|
// alert(res.operator)
|
|
|
if (res.operator != '' && res.inspector != ''){
|
|
|
$("#c-operator").val(res.operator);
|
|
|
@@ -220,6 +224,7 @@ define(['jquery', 'bootstrap', 'backend', 'table', 'form','jQuery.print','jquery
|
|
|
var str = '';//页面table
|
|
|
var html = '';//打印的table
|
|
|
for(var i=0;i<result.data.length;i++){
|
|
|
+ console.log(result.data[i]);
|
|
|
str += "<tr class='tablestr"+i+" tablestr'><td><input class='form-control material' type='text' name='row[material][]' readonly value='"+result.data[i].material+"'></td>";
|
|
|
str += "<td><input class='form-control nweight' type='text' name='row[nweight][]' readonly value='"+result.data[i].nweight+"'></td>";
|
|
|
str += "<td style='display: none'><input class='form-control gy_num' type='hidden' name='row[gy_num][]' value='"+result.data[i].gy_num+"'></td>";
|
|
|
@@ -233,7 +238,7 @@ define(['jquery', 'bootstrap', 'backend', 'table', 'form','jQuery.print','jquery
|
|
|
str += "<td><button type=\"button\" class=\"btn btn-primary btn-embossed submit \">保存</button></td>";
|
|
|
str += "<td><input class='form-control bach' type='text' name='row[bach][]' value=''></td>";
|
|
|
}else{
|
|
|
- str += "<td><button type=\"button\" class=\"btn btn-primary btn-embossed\">已保存</button></td>";
|
|
|
+ str += "<td><button type=\"button\" class=\"btn btn-primary btn-embossed submit \" disabled>已保存</button></td>";
|
|
|
str += "<td><input class='form-control bach' type='text' name='row[bach][]' disabled readonly value='"+result.data[i].material_bach+"'></td>";
|
|
|
}
|
|
|
// if(result.data[i].material_bach){
|
|
|
@@ -476,9 +481,8 @@ define(['jquery', 'bootstrap', 'backend', 'table', 'form','jQuery.print','jquery
|
|
|
// console.log("应投重量"+$(this).parent().siblings().eq(1).children('input').val());
|
|
|
// console.log("工艺序号:"+$(this).parent().siblings().eq(2).children('input').val());
|
|
|
// console.log("投料重量"+$(this).parent().siblings().eq(3).children('input').val());
|
|
|
- // console.log("原材料_批次号"$(this).parent().siblings().eq(4).children('input').val());
|
|
|
+ // console.log("原材料_批次号"+$(this).parent().siblings().eq(4).children('input').val());
|
|
|
// console.log("操作记录"+$(this).parent().siblings().eq(5).children('input').val());
|
|
|
-
|
|
|
// if($(this).parent().siblings().eq(2).children('input').attr('readonly') == true){
|
|
|
// layer.confirm('此原材料已经保存',{
|
|
|
// title:'操作提示',
|
|
|
@@ -522,7 +526,10 @@ define(['jquery', 'bootstrap', 'backend', 'table', 'form','jQuery.print','jquery
|
|
|
window.speechSynthesis.speak(msg);
|
|
|
}else{
|
|
|
$(this).text('已保存');
|
|
|
+ // $(this).text('修改');
|
|
|
+ //禁用投料重量
|
|
|
$(this).parent().siblings().eq(3).children('input').attr('disabled',true);
|
|
|
+ // 禁用原材料批次号
|
|
|
$(this).parent().siblings().eq(4).children('input').attr('disabled',true);
|
|
|
$(this).attr('disabled',true);
|
|
|
}
|
|
|
@@ -547,6 +554,31 @@ define(['jquery', 'bootstrap', 'backend', 'table', 'form','jQuery.print','jquery
|
|
|
});
|
|
|
}
|
|
|
});
|
|
|
+ //投料重量 修改
|
|
|
+ // $(document).on('click','.submits',function () {
|
|
|
+ // // $(this).text('保存');
|
|
|
+ // var bach = $("#c-bach").val();
|
|
|
+ // var weight = $(this).parent().siblings().eq(3).children('input').val();
|
|
|
+ // $(this).parent().siblings().eq(3).children('input').removeAttr("readonly");
|
|
|
+ // $.ajax({
|
|
|
+ // type: "POST",
|
|
|
+ // url: "feeding/submits",
|
|
|
+ // data: {
|
|
|
+ // weight: weight,
|
|
|
+ // bach: bach,
|
|
|
+ // },
|
|
|
+ // success:function(data) {
|
|
|
+ // console.log("ajax"+data);
|
|
|
+ // if(data == '修改失败'){
|
|
|
+ // console.log(111);
|
|
|
+ // $(this).text('修改');
|
|
|
+ // $(this).parent().siblings().eq(3).children('input').attr('disabled',true);
|
|
|
+ // $(this).attr('disabled',true);
|
|
|
+ // }
|
|
|
+ // }
|
|
|
+ // });
|
|
|
+ //
|
|
|
+ // })
|
|
|
|
|
|
$('input').keydown( function (e) {
|
|
|
let key = e.which;
|
|
|
@@ -571,7 +603,7 @@ define(['jquery', 'bootstrap', 'backend', 'table', 'form','jQuery.print','jquery
|
|
|
$("#formula").val($("#name").val());
|
|
|
//添加重量,包装规格,机组到表格内
|
|
|
for(var i=0;i<$(".tablestr").length;i++){
|
|
|
- var weight = parseFloat($(".tablestr:eq("+i+")").children("tr td:eq(2)").children().val());
|
|
|
+ var weight = parseFloat($(".tablestr:eq("+i+")").children("tr td:eq(3)").children().val());
|
|
|
if(weight){
|
|
|
$(".print:eq("+i+")").children("tr td:eq(2)").html(weight);
|
|
|
total += weight;
|
|
|
@@ -606,7 +638,7 @@ define(['jquery', 'bootstrap', 'backend', 'table', 'form','jQuery.print','jquery
|
|
|
return false;
|
|
|
});
|
|
|
function createQrcode(txt,width,height) {
|
|
|
- $("#qrcode").qrcode({
|
|
|
+ $(".qrcode").qrcode({
|
|
|
render: "canvas",//canvas和table两种渲染方式
|
|
|
width: width,
|
|
|
height: height,
|